Carbamate
Carbamic-acid ester insecticides (carbaryl, carbofuran, propoxur, aldicarb). Reversibly inhibit acetylcholinesterase by carbamylating the active-site serine; spontaneous decarbamylation makes oximes unnecessary and sometimes harmful.
